How Our Same Day Water Removal Process Works
We understand that water damage can be stressful and overwhelming. That’s why we’ve developed a straightforward process to make it easy for you. Our team will walk you through every step of the way, from assessment to completion.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Identify the source of the water damage to prevent further leaks. Our team will contain the affected area to prevent water from spreading to other parts of your property.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
We’ll use high-capacity pumps and water extraction equipment to remove standing water and excess moisture from your property. This process typically takes 60-90 minutes to complete.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will set up indust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out your property and prevent mold growth. This process typically takes 3-5 days to complete.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Once the drying process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is dry and safe. We’ll also remove any remaining equipment and clean up the affected area.

Warning Signs You Need Same Day Water Removal
Catching these warning sign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ent more extensive damage. Don’t ignore these signs, call our team right away.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old growth or water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s likely a sign that water has seeped into the walls or floors.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Buckled or warped flooring can be a sign that water has damaged the subfloor or the flooring material itself. If you notice this issue, call our team immediately to prevent further damage.
Stains or Discoloration on Walls or Ceilings
Stains or discoloration on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age or leaks.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ent more extensive damage.
Water Stains or Rings on Ceilings
Water stains or rings on ceilings can be a sign of a roof leak or water damage. If you notice these signs, call our team to inspect and repair the issue.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. If you notice this issue, it’s essential to address the underlying cause quickly to prevent more extensive damage.
Water Damage in Electrical Outlets or Switches
Water damage in electrical outlets or switches can be a serious safety hazard. If you notice this issue, call our team immediately to prevent electrical shocks or fires.

Same Day Water Removal Cost in Royal Pines, NC
The cost of Same Day Water Removal var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Royal Pines, NC. These estimates are based on real-world costs and prices may vary based on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and local labor costs.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, number of equipment required, and local labor costs. |
| Final inspection and cleanup |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, number of equipment required, and local labor costs. |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and consultations to ensure you understand the costs involved and the scope of work required.
